Download Mirror EU - Netherlands ... WebAug 17, 2014 · Description. CrystalDiskInfo is a HDD/SSD utility software which shows the health status much more clearly than similar tools. The "Function / Graph" is especially interesting for the "Reallocated Sectors Count". If it increases over time or is very high already, the hard drive may need to be replaced. Launch CrystalDiskInfo from your desktop, and you’ll see a bunch of information about your SSD, as shown below. Depending on your SSD’s health, the health status either appears Green (good), Yellow (caution), Red (failed), or Gray (unknown state). fly like you swing
